Do You Really Need a Stabilizer for Your AC?

In India the voltage is usually around 220V, but the truth always does not stay the same. When it is really hot in the summer the voltage can go down a lot because many people are using electricity at the same time. And when there are storms or the power goes out the voltage can jump up high. These changes in voltage can impact your AC’s compressor and the circuit board inside.

A lot of people think that inverter air conditioners do not need a stabilizer because they already have built-in protection. That protection only works for small changes in voltage. If the voltage goes down low or jumps up really high your air conditioner can still get damaged. When the voltage is low it can put stress on the compressor and that can affect how well the air conditioner cools.

Air conditioners that are not inverters are more likely to get damaged because they usually do not have good protection against voltage changes. That is why it is ideal to use a voltage stabilizer, with both inverter and non-inverter air conditioners. It is especially important if you live in a place where the power goes out a lot. Moreover, places where the voltage is often low or where the voltage changes a lot during the day, a stabilizer is much needed. A stabilizer helps keep your air conditioner safe and makes it last longer.

How to Choose the Right Stabilizer for Your AC?

When buying an air conditioner stabilizer, do not just consider the size of the air conditioner. There are a few things to consider also such as:

  • Voltage Range: You should check how well the stabilizer can handle voltage fluctuations. A good stabilizer works well between 130V and 280V. If you live in an area where the voltage is mostly low, especially where power cuts are common (rural belts, UP, Rajasthan, Bihar) a model rated around 90V is good enough for protection.
  • VA Rating: The stabilizer should have a higher capacity than what your air conditioner uses. Ideally, a stabilizer with 20–25% more VA capacity than your AC's running wattage is used. Whereas, for a 1.5-ton AC consuming around 1500W, a 4 KVA stabilizer provides comfortable headroom. This allows it to respond to changes in electrical load easily and keeps your air conditioner running safely. 
  • Time Delay System: This feature helps protect the compressor after a power cut. Instead of turning the air conditioner on immediately, the stabilizer waits for 3-5 minutes before restarting it. This helps prevent damage to the compressor and makes the air conditioner last longer.
  • Winding Material: Stabilizers with copper winding usually last longer and work better in heat. Aluminium and Copper winding are lighter and affordable, making them a good option for areas with voltage issues.
  • Display: A digital display is more useful than LED indicators because it shows both the input and output voltages. This helps you know if there are any voltage problems at home.
  • Warranty: Longer warranty generally means the stabilizer is more reliable.  Good quality stabilizer brands offer around 5 years of warranty support.
  • Design: Wall-mounted stabilizers save space and are safer from dust, water, and accidental damage at home. This is something to consider when buying a stabilizer for your air conditioner.

Best Stabilizer for 2-Ton AC

A 2-Ton air conditioner usually uses 2000 watts to 2500 watts of power. To run this AC safely you should use at least a 5 KVA stabilizer. A big stabilizer is better because it needs power when the compressor is starting.

When a 2-Ton AC starts up the power usage can briefly become 2 or 3 times higher than normal. If the stabilizer is too small it may keep tripping or put stress on the compressor. These types of ACs are commonly used in large bedrooms, living rooms, halls and small offices. That is why choosing a stabilizer with capacity and a wide voltage range is important for smooth and long-lasting performance.

Is Stabilizer for Inverter AC Any Different?

A lot of people wonder if a stabilizer for inverter ac 1.5-Ton needs a type other than regular ACs. The answer is no. The type of stabilizer is mostly the same but the features of the stabilizer become much more important for inverter air conditioners.

Inverter ACs use electronics to control the speed of the compressor and save electricity. These parts of ACs are more sensitive to voltage fluctuations. That is why a stabilizer with a voltage range and a time delay system is important. It helps to give power and also prevent damage from sudden restarts after a power cut.

When you are buying a stabilizer, look for models that are marked as "inverter AC compatible". Features like low-voltage support and high-voltage cut-off and time delay protection can help increase the life of the compressor and the internal circuit board.

For homes, a 4 KVA stabilizer with a wide working range is a reliable choice for an inverter ac stabilizer 1.5-Ton. If the area you live in faces low voltage regularly then choosing a higher-capacity stabilizer with stronger low-voltage support is the safer option. Many Reddit users and buyers also recommend stabilizers, with voltage range and time delay systems for better long-term protection.

Key features to look for in an inverter AC stabilizer:

  • Wide input range (130V–280V minimum; 90V–280V for extreme areas)
  • Built-in time delay relay (3–5 minutes)
  • Digital display for real-time voltage monitoring
  • ISI-certified components
  • 5-year warranty from the brand

Smart Tips You Should Keep in Mind Before Buying Stabilizer for AC

Smart Tips You Should Keep in Mind Before Buying AC Stabilizer
  • Never size a stabilizer exactly to your AC's wattage: You should always get a stabilizer which has at least 20-25% extra capacity for safety. ACs need a lot of power for a few seconds when the compressor starts and a stabilizer that is a bit bigger can handle this easily without turning off.
  • Check your area's voltage history before buying: If your home often has voltage, especially below 150V then you should choose an AC stabilizer with a wider voltage range like 90V or 130V for better protection.
  • Check your area's voltage history before buying: Copper handles heat better, lasts longer and works efficiently than aluminium especially if your AC runs for many hours every day.
  • A time delay is not optional: After a power cut, the stabilizer waits for a few minutes before it restarts the AC. Time delay protects the compressor from restart damage and hence, helps in increasing compressor life.
  • Look for ISI Certified Models: This ensures that the product follows safety and quality standards making the stabilizer safer and more reliable for daily use.
  • Do not share one stabilizer across multiple ACs: Every AC should have its dedicated stabilizer based on its tonnage and power requirement.
  • Always check the warranty period: A longer warranty usually shows that the brand trusts the quality of its product and offers long term support.
  • Wall mount is preferred over floor mount: They save space, stay safer, from water or dust and are harder for children to reach by accident.

Q2. How much kilowatt stabilizer is required for a 1.5 ton AC?

A 1.5 ton AC typically consumes around 1200–1500W. You need at least a 4 KVA (4000 VA) stabilizer, with 20–25% headroom above the AC's rated wattage. A 5 KVA gives an extra surge, as it is considered as a smart long-term investment.  

Q3. Do inverter ACs need a stabilizer?

Yes, this is really important in areas where the electricity supply's not very stable. Many times, inverter ACs can have trouble in handling changes in voltage.  That is why voltage stabilizer is needed. This device provides a layer of protection for the AC. Especially, internal parts cannot protect themselves when the voltage gets too low or too high. It acts as a shield if voltage spikes above 260V or drops below 160V.

Q4. What VA stabilizer is needed for a 1.5 ton AC?

A minimum of 4000 VA (4 KVA) is recommended for a best ac stabilizer 1.5 ton selection. If you run the AC more than 10 hours daily or your area has common fluctuations, a 5 KVA model is the safer choice. 

Q5. Can I use a 4 KVA stabilizer for a 2 ton AC?

No. A 2 ton AC requires a 2 ton ac stabilizer rated at 5 KVA minimum. If you use a stabilizer that's too small it will trip a lot when you start up and it can get too hot, hence making the compressor wear out faster. Using the wrong size stabilizer can hurt the stabilizer and the AC compressor, which might also result in excessive headload. 

Q6. What is the ideal voltage range for an AC stabilizer in India?

For most Indian cities, a 150V–280V range is adequate. For semi-urban areas and towns, 130V–280V is recommended. For rural areas and states with severe voltage instability (UP, Bihar, MP, Rajasthan), a 90V–280V stabilizer like the Amekra 5 KVA 90V Copper provides maximum protection.
